All members of City Council have an obligation to act honestly and responsibly when making decisions. City Councillors will declare conflicts of interest when a topic arises in which they may have a direct or indirect conflict. The below is a current registry of all declared conflicts by City Councillors.

In accordance with s.5.1 of the Municipal Conflict of Interest Act, at a meeting which a member discloses an interest under section 5, or as soon as possible afterwards, the member shall file a written statement of interest and its general nature with the City Clerk of the Municipality or the secretary of the committee or local board, as the case may be.  In accordance with s.6.1 of the Municipal Conflict of Interest Act, every municipality and local board shall establish and maintain a registry in which shall be kept,

  1. A copy of each statement filed under s.5.1. and

  2. A copy of each declaration recorded under s. 6

The registry shall be available to the public for inspection in the manner and during the time of that the municipality or local board, as the case may be, may determine.
